Kershner Award for Dr Huddle11/05/2010 |
| The PLANS Executive Committee presented its Kershner Award to Dr. James Huddle at the IEEE/ION PLANS Symposium (PLANS) 2010 in Palm Springs, California, USA, Thursday, 6th May 2010. Dr. Huddle was recognised for his work on inertial and multi-sensor navigation and referencing systems. |

3D Scanning of Historic Sugar Factories |
|
The Alliance for Integrated Spatial Technologies at the University of South Florida, USA, recently worked with the Florida Park Service on a project to document the remains of several historic sugar-mill sites in the State Parks to create as-builts to be used in preservation and conservation of these resources. The FARO LS 880, along with GPS and total station georeferencing and colour imaging, was used on these projects.
